Application is developed with Node.js tech stack, so you need node
and npm
in order to build and run it locally.
First, clone this repository
git clone https://github.com/bidiu/weather-app.git
and then switch to the project's root directory
cd weather-app
and then install dependencies
npm install
and then rename ./config.example.js
to ./config.js
, edit it as following
// https://openweathermap.org/appid
// put the weather API key down below
config.apiKey = 'Your weather API key goes here';
and then build the project
./node_modules/.bin/webpack
or build for production
./node_modules/.bin/webpack --config webpack.production.config.js
and then start the server
DEBUG=weather-app:* npm start
finally, open a browser, go to the following URL
http://localhost:3000
- Only been tested on Chrome, Firefox and Safari
- Currently not responsive
- This application uses HTML5 Geolocation API to provide weather data of user's current location
- Geolocation is banned in Safari in Sierra (macOS 10.12) for insecure connections, even with localhost.
